Scientists have made a groundbreaking discovery on Mars, uncovering a massive volcano and a possible buried glacier ice sheet near the equator of the red planet. The volcano is located in the eastern part of Mars’ Tharsis volcanic province and is said to rival other giant volcanoes on Mars in diameter. The structure, which is centered at 7° 35′ S, 93° 55′ W, reaches an impressive elevation of +9022 meters and spans a staggering 450 kilometers in width. NASA’s Europa Clipper Set to Launch in October with Unique Artistic Touch NASA’s Europa Clipper spacecraft is set to launch in October with a special touch that honors its connection to Earth. The spacecraft will carry a richly layered dispatch that includes more than 2.6 million names submitted by the public. Additionally, a triangular metal plate featuring artworks and engravings will be on board.
